The Arnold Palmer legacy was alive and well at the 2023 AP Invitational in Orlando. It was three months of work to bring this fan experience to life, sharing one of the most monumental stories in sports. A massive thank you to The Arnold & Winnie Palmer Foundation and Ideas United for bringing me onboard to creative direct this thing. With the help of the Arnold & Winnie Palmer Foundation we organized the fan experience into a series of themed rooms and tapped the Palmer archive for photos, trophies, and trinkets to represent a legendary life and career.

  • 5,635 Guests

    Guests passed through our doors during the Arnold Palmer Invitational.

  • 537 Leads

    Leads captured from guests interested in learning more about the Arnold & Winnie Palmer Foundation and the Latrobe Legacy Campaign.

  • 100+ Fan Stories

    Through multiple digital activations on site we are able to capture fan stories as they walked through the experience.

  • 1,300 Swings

    At the Swing Like the King station guests could took a swing using Arnold Palmer’s clubs.

  • 10K visitors to campaign website

    The experience marked the launch of the Latrobe Legacy campaign at sincerlyarnoldpalmer.org
